Is it legal to scrape data from LinkedIn?
While scraping data from LinkedIn is technically possible, it is essential to adhere to LinkedIn's terms of service and data usage policies. Unauthorized scraping may violate these terms, leading to restrictions on your account or legal consequences. Always ensure compliance with relevant regulations and platform guidelines.
